Default anyone moved factory backup camera in 08 h2?

cant see much out of the back up camera in 08 h2 because it is mounted on bumper below the spare tire... anyone had rear camera mounted anywhere else to improve visibility? i am thinking maybe on the top of the car.

Default Re: anyone moved factory backup camera in 08 h2?

Hi i didn't move my 08 factory camera, but i added a second camera to the spare tire cover and its better for seeing behind. The factory one is great for hooking to a trailer, i leave the mirror turned off so the screen doesn't slide out till hooking to a trailer. The tire cover camera is hooked to the nav screen it works great.

Default Re: anyone moved factory backup camera in 08 h2?

tracy... the gmx 322 allowed you to have the additional video input i assume. I orderd the new bluestar 2010 component to replace my onstar. My question is, will the bluestar and the gmx 322 work fine together?

I ask because i believe the mute button can be used by the bluestar system and it is used to switch between locked and unlock modes with the gmx 322...

I might be completely wrong about this (having confused a number of different products that i have learned about)

Default Re: anyone moved factory backup camera in 08 h2?

Hi they do work together but i have to turn the rear and front camera on and off from the window switch not the mute button because it will turn on the bluetooth. This is only when you turn the camera on with the window switch not when its in auto mode just put in rev and the camera comes on. I use the mute or talking mouth button only for the bluestar unit. If you do hit the mute button to cancell the camera you also have to hit the onstar button to cancell the phone, hope this helps
